5. Your x-ray test indicates that a valve on the blow-out preventer is cracked for this new well. The test has a 99.0% probability of detecting a crack if present, but a 0.5% probability of detecting a crack if not present. There is a 0.2% probability of having a crack (before the test). a) What is the probability that the valve is cracked given the test says it is Recall Bayes' Theorem: P(BIA) = P(A/B) P(B) = P(A) P(A/B) P(B) P(A/B) P(B) + P(A/B) P(BC) b) What is the probability the valve is cracked given the test says it is not cracked
